The Dual Element is an OEM part for Frigidaire ranges. This element features two heating zones, allowing for versatile cooking options by providing both high and low heat settings on the same burner. It ensures efficient and consistent heating, making it ideal for various cooking tasks. It contains a 9-inch, 1200-watt element and a 6-inch, 1300-watt element, combining for 2500 watts at 240 volts

Causes of a bad dual element can include electrical issues, wear and tear from regular use, or physical damage such as cracks or breaks in the heating element. These issues can lead to inconsistent heating or complete failure of the element.

Symptoms of a bad dual element include:

  • Burner not heating up
  • Inconsistent or uneven heating
  • Element not switching between high and low heat
  • Visible damage to the element

The Monitor Switch is an OEM replacement part for GE microwave ovens. Located internally on the turntable control circuit board, this switch monitors rotation of the turntable during cooking cycles.  

Causes of failure involve degradation of the electrical contacts from continuous arcing loads over years of use combined with vibration stresses.

Symptoms of a faulty monitor switch include:

  • The turntable no longer rotates or spinning intermittently
  • Cooking cycles aborting prematurely with error messages 
  • Screeching or grinding noises emanating from beneath cavity
  • Visible burnt spots on turntable drive assembly

The first symptom was our microwave would continue to run after the time was up. The light would go out, the turn table would stop but you could still hear the microwave running and whatever was in it would continue to cook. The only way to stop it was to open the door. It was intermittent at first but eventually it would always run no matter what as long as the door was closed. Several other posts referenced these switches as the problem. The Broil Element is an OEM replacement part for Frigidaire ovens. It is located at the top of the oven cavity and is responsible for providing the high heat required for broiling. This element heats up quickly and evenly to cook food from above, giving it a crisp and browned finish.

Over time, the broil element can degrade due to the high temperatures it operates under, as well as normal wear and tear from repeated use. Electrical surges or physical damage from cleaning or moving oven racks can also cause the element to fail. These factors can lead to the element no longer heating up properly or becoming completely non-functional.

Symptoms of a bad broil element include:

  • The broiler not heating up or heating unevenly
  • Visible signs of damage such as burns, blisters, or breaks in the element
  • Sparking or unusual noises when attempting to use the broiler
  • The oven taking longer to broil food or not achieving the desired browning effect
  • The element not glowing red-hot during operation

The Oven Temperature Sensor is an OEM part for Whirlpool ovens. It measures the oven's internal temperature and sends this information to the control board to maintain the desired cooking temperature. 

Causes of a bad temperature sensor can include exposure to high temperatures over long periods, electrical issues such as short circuits, or physical damage due to impact or mishandling.

Symptoms of a bad temperature sensor include:

  • Inaccurate temperature readings
  • Oven not heating to the set temperature
  • Oven overheating
  • Error codes displayed on the oven control panel

The Oven Control Thermostat is an OEM replacement part for GE ovens. It regulates the oven temperature by turning the heating elements on and off to maintain the desired temperature set by the user. This thermostat ensures accurate and consistent cooking temperatures, which is crucial for optimal baking and roasting results.

Causes of a bad oven control thermostat can include prolonged exposure to high temperatures, wear and tear from frequent use, or electrical issues such as power surges that can damage the thermostat's internal components. Additionally, improper handling or accidental impact during maintenance or cleaning can affect its functionality.

Symptoms of a bad oven control thermostat include:

  • The oven not reaching the set temperature
  • Inconsistent or fluctuating oven temperatures
  • The oven overheating or underheating
  • Error codes or malfunctioning temperature settings
  • The oven not turning on or off correctly

The Coil Burner Element is an OEM replacement part for Frigidaire cooktops and ranges. The 6-inch coil burner element typically consists of a spiral-shaped metal resistance wire or rod that glows red-hot when electricity passes through it. This heat is then transferred to the cooktop surface, allowing it to reach the desired temperature for various cooking tasks, such as boiling, simmering, or sautéing.

Symptoms of a bad coil burner element:

  • Burner not heating up properly or failing to reach the desired temperature
  • Uneven heating or hot spots on the cooktop surface
  • Visible damage or breaks in the coil wire
  • Unusual smells or burning odors emanating from the burner area

Causes of a bad coil burner element can include mechanical failure, electrical malfunctions, or simply reaching the end of its lifespan due to repeated heating and cooling cycles.
